Getting to Fenway Park

Fenway Park is exceptionally well-served by Boston's public transportation network. The nearest 'T' (subway) station is Fenway on the Green Line D branch, which is just a short walk, typically no more than five minutes, to the ballpark. Additionally, several bus routes stop in the vicinity, offering further convenience. For those travelling from further afield, the Back Bay station, a major hub for commuter rail and Amtrak, is also within a reasonable walking distance, approximately 20-25 minutes. Given the popularity of Red Sox games, it is strongly recommended to arrive at least 90 minutes before the scheduled game start to allow ample time for security checks, finding your seats, and soaking in the pre-game atmosphere.

Parking in the immediate vicinity of Fenway Park is notoriously limited and extremely expensive. It is generally not recommended for attendees to rely on driving and parking for this event. Instead, utilising the efficient public transport system is by far the most practical and stress-free option. For those who still prefer to drive, there are numerous commercial parking garages in the Fenway area, but be prepared for significant costs and potential traffic congestion on game days. Alternative transport options such as ride-sharing services are also readily available, though surge pricing can apply during peak times.

Getting to Fenway Park, Boston

By train

Getting to Fenway Park via train is a highly convenient option for many visitors. The closest MBTA (Massachusetts Bay Transportation Authority) subway station is Fenway, served by the Green Line D branch. This station is located just a short walk from the ballpark, approximately 2 minutes and roughly 150 meters away. The Green Line provides direct service and connections to various parts of Boston, including downtown, Cambridge, and Brookline. While Amtrak services do not stop directly at Fenway, passengers arriving via Amtrak can connect to the MBTA commuter rail network or the subway system at major hubs like South Station or Back Bay Station, both of which offer easy transfers to the Green Line. Frequent service is available on the MBTA system throughout the day, with reduced service late at night. Journey times from across the Greater Boston area are generally short, typically under 30 minutes from downtown Boston. Fenway station offers basic amenities, and accessibility information should be confirmed with the MBTA for specific needs.

By bus

Several bus routes provide convenient access to Fenway Park, making it a viable option for reaching the venue. The primary bus stop is located near the intersection of Brookline Avenue and Boylston Street, within easy walking distance of the ballpark, typically just a few minutes. Key bus routes serving this area include the MBTA's 60, 65, and CT2 buses. Route 60 connects Cambridge to Brookline, while Route 65 links Cleveland Circle to Kenmore Square, with both passing near the venue. The CT2 bus offers service between Kendall Square and Ruggles Station, also providing access. These routes connect various neighborhoods, including parts of Cambridge, Brookline, and Boston's Back Bay and Fenway areas. While most local bus services do not run 24 hours, the MBTA offers late-night service on some key routes, and the Silver Line (SL1, SL2, SL3, SL4, SL5) provides 24-hour service to certain parts of the city, though a transfer would be necessary for Fenway.

By car & parking

Driving to Fenway Park requires navigating Boston's often busy streets, but it is manageable with clear directions. The ballpark is located in the Fenway-Kenmore neighborhood of Boston. For GPS navigation, using the address of the ballpark itself or nearby intersections like Brookline Avenue and Lansdowne Street is recommended. The nearest ZIP code is 02215. Parking options around Fenway Park are primarily in the form of numerous private parking lots and garages. Street parking is extremely limited and often restricted on event days. Expect to pay anywhere from $30-$60 or more for event parking, with prices varying based on demand and proximity. Some lots may offer hourly rates earlier in the day, but event pricing typically takes over. Park and ride options are available by utilizing the MBTA system; driving to a station on the outskirts of the city and taking the subway in is often more cost-effective and less stressful. Accessible parking spaces are typically available in designated lots, and drop-off zones are usually located near the main entrances.

Accessibility

Fenway Park is committed to providing an accessible experience for all guests. The venue is largely ADA wheelchair accessible, with accessible entrances, elevators, and designated seating areas available throughout the ballpark. Accessible restrooms are located in multiple areas, equipped to accommodate guests with disabilities. For guests with hearing impairments, Fenway Park may offer hearing loop or induction loop systems, and information on their availability should be confirmed with the venue prior to arrival. Service animals are welcome at Fenway Park, provided they are under the control of their handler. Companion care facilities are available. Accessible parking is provided in designated areas, and there are accessible drop-off zones near the main entrances. Venue staff are trained to offer assistance to guests with disabilities, ensuring a comfortable and enjoyable visit. It is always recommended to contact the venue's guest services department in advance to arrange any specific needs or to confirm the availability of accessibility features for your event.
